Wortham’s father, Thomas Wortham III, himself a retired Chicago police sergeant, said at Taylor and McGee’s trials in 2014 that he saw much of the attack unfold while in his slippers, first from the doorway of his house as the two men attempted to rob his son, then on the street as he engaged the Floyds in a gunbattle.
